Definition of NEX:

  • NESTS is a separate board of the Venture Exchange that provides a specialized trading forum for listed companies that is not bound by the listing standards of the current TSX Venture Exchange. KNEX is aimed at companies that have small business activities or are no longer active. This allows these companies to add some liquidity to their stock and give them the legitimacy to attract potential buyers or investors. These companies are identified by an extension of H or K in their trademark.
